Merger Effects on Summer Associates

I was wondering if anyone knew how a merger between 2 law firms effects a summer associates chances of receiving an offer. If a firm is attempting to merge, is it because they are financially unstable?

A merger might affect summer associate offers, but a merger doesn't mean a firm is financially unstable. Many times a merger is contemplated because two firms want to take advantage of economies of scale and lower costs which can help profitability. Mergers aren't easy to do and sometimes problems can result that may or may not affect all personnel, attorneys and staff alike, but a merger in and of itself isn't a harbinger of doom.
